Brush Machine Applications in Textile Manufacturing: Cleaning Fabric and Machinery

Introduction:

The textile industry is a complex and intricate sector that requires utmost precision and attention to detail. One crucial aspect of textile manufacturing is the efficient cleaning of both fabric and machinery. This is where brush machines play a significant role. With their unique design and specialized brushes, these machines have revolutionized the textile manufacturing process, ensuring impeccable cleanliness and operational efficiency. In this article, we will delve into the various applications of brush machines in textile manufacturing and explore how they have enhanced the overall quality and productivity in this industry.

The Importance of Cleaning in Textile Manufacturing

Cleanliness is of paramount importance in textile manufacturing. Any traces of dirt, dust, or lint can have catastrophic effects on the final product's quality and durability, leading to customer dissatisfaction and ultimately financial losses for the manufacturers. Moreover, textile machinery, such as looms and spinning frames, can accumulate debris, lubricants, and other substances during the manufacturing process, hampering their performance and lifespan. Therefore, implementing effective cleaning measures is crucial for maintaining a high standard of cleanliness throughout the textile manufacturing process.

The Role of Brush Machines in Cleaning Fabric

Fabric cleaning is an essential step in textile manufacturing that ultimately determines the quality and appearance of the final product. Brush machines have revolutionized fabric cleaning by providing an efficient and thorough cleaning method. These machines utilize specially designed brushes that effectively remove dirt, lint, and other contaminants from the fabric's surface. The brushes are carefully selected based on the fabric type, ensuring optimal cleaning without causing any damage or distortion to the material.

One of the significant advantages of brush machines in fabric cleaning is their versatility. They can handle a wide range of fabrics, including delicate materials like silk and lace, as well as sturdier ones like denim and canvas. The brushes' adjustable speed and pressure settings allow manufacturers to customize the cleaning process according to the fabric's specific requirements, ensuring optimal results while preserving the fabric's integrity.

Moreover, brush machines also excel in removing residual chemicals or dyes from the fabric, enhancing its final appearance and texture. By thoroughly scrubbing the fabric surface, these machines eliminate any remnants of chemicals that may affect the dyeing or finishing processes, resulting in a cleaner, more vibrant fabric.

Brush Machines for Cleaning Textile Machinery

In addition to fabric cleaning, brush machines also play a crucial role in maintaining and cleaning textile machinery. Throughout the manufacturing process, textile machinery tends to accumulate debris, oils, and other contaminants, compromising their performance and longevity. Brush machines provide an efficient solution for keeping these machines clean and well-maintained.

These specialized machines utilize powerful brushes that effectively remove debris, dust, and lubricants from various components of textile machinery. By implementing regular cleaning schedules using brush machines, manufacturers can prevent the build-up of contaminants that may lead to operational issues, decreased efficiency, and costly repairs.

The key advantage of using brush machines for cleaning textile machinery is their ability to reach inaccessible areas. The brushes' fine bristles can efficiently clean intricate parts and components, such as crevices, gears, and nooks, that are challenging to reach manually. By thoroughly removing dirt and other contaminants, brush machines ensure optimal performance and minimize the risk of breakdowns or malfunctions.

Enhancing Operational Efficiency with Brush Machines

Implementing brush machines in textile manufacturing not only improves cleanliness but also enhances operational efficiency. These machines are designed to operate at high speeds, allowing for swift and thorough cleaning without compromising productivity. With advanced automation features, brush machines can be seamlessly integrated into existing production lines, efficiently cleaning fabric and machinery without causing any interruptions.

Brush machines also contribute to time and cost savings in textile manufacturing. As manual cleaning methods are labor-intensive and time-consuming, utilizing brush machines significantly reduces cleaning time, freeing up resources for other crucial tasks. Additionally, the longevity of textile machinery is extended through regular and effective cleaning, minimizing the need for costly repairs or replacements.
